Start by rinsing the buffing pad with water to remove any loose debris or residue from the surface. It’s no secret that a clean pad works better than a dirty pad. Luckily, cleaning a buffing wheel is a quick process. Start the blade running and then offer the blade side of your wheel rake to the buffing wheel. Gently work the wheel rake back and forth across the face of the buffing wheel until it looks bright and fluffy again.
